Essential tips for spotting the warning signs of fraudulent betting apps for secure play and prevent financial loss in digital gambling environments

Recognising the common indicators of fake betting platforms can help users steer clear of scams that compromise their personal data and funds, Suspicious gambling apps tend to seek confidential information unrelated to gameplay, indicating potential scam activity, Apps offering unrealistic guarantees of winning or showing aggressive marketing tactics are often scams designed to deceive, Negative feedback, missing licensing details, unpolished interfaces, or unresponsive support channels are common signals of scam sites
